Nwlapcug.com


Pro Quad-Core & Cons



La tendenza di unità centrale di elaborazione multi-core che ha cominciato con CPU dual-core è ora leader gli utenti di computer a pensare circa i vantaggi e gli svantaggi di CPU quad-core invece. Anche se hanno due volte il numero di processori, computer quad-core non può portare allo stesso aumento delle prestazioni del sistema come sperimentato da persone aggiornamento da single core per CPU dual-core. I pro ei contro di CPU quad-core dovrebbe essere pesati con attenzione prima di prendere una decisione sul vostro prossimo acquisto di computer.

Velocità di elaborazione più veloce

La pro chiave di un processore multi-core risiede nella sua capacità di eseguire un maggior numero di calcoli simultanei. Questo è particolarmente utile per le applicazioni che offrono luoghi logici per calcolo parallelo---per esempio un gioco per computer che gestisce i calcoli per l'intelligenza artificiale separatamente dai calcoli per visualizzare la grafica del gioco. Tale applicazione è noto, nel gergo del computer, come essere "multithreading" perché, piuttosto che una lunga sequenza, contiene molti brevi sequenze legati insieme. Se un'applicazione è correttamente multithreading, processori quad-core hanno un vantaggio rispetto ai processori con meno core perché hanno più potenza di elaborazione disponibile.

Rendimenti decrescenti

Purtroppo, è più difficile ottimizzare le applicazioni per più di due core: lo sviluppatore deve assicurarsi che le istruzioni terminano alle circa lo stesso tempo per evitare cicli di processore sprecato, un atto di equilibrio che diventa più difficile, come aumenta il numero di core. Di conseguenza, processori quad-core non sono quasi quattro volte più velocemente di processori single-core e può essere meno efficienti di processori dual-core ad alta potenza, perché i nuclei rimangono inutilizzati una percentuale maggiore del tempo.

Una maggiore versatilità della virtualizzazione

In alcuni casi, il computer possono fare uso di core multipli senza avere le applicazioni che sono in modo esplicito con multithreading. Molti server di computer, ad esempio, sono "virtualizzato"---da permettere qualcuno ad operare molti diversi "Server" sullo stesso computer fisico. In ambienti virtualizzati, quad-core computer consentono un maggior numero di computer per essere emulato allo stesso tempo, perché ogni ambiente virtuale può essere facilmente attribuiti il proprio nucleo.

Costi

Per gli utenti domestici non funzionano generalmente di server virtuali, i vantaggi dei processori quad-core non possono necessariamente essere come ovvio o come drammatico. Perché sono più complessi da progettare, processori quad-core sono generalmente più costosi per l'acquisto di un processore dual-core della velocità equivalente. Sono anche più costosi da operare a causa del consumo di energia aumento; per linea di AMD di processori Phenom II, un processore quad-core consuma più del 50% di potenza in più rispetto a un processore con la stessa velocità con solo due core.